For Sale
£ 180,000
For Sale
£ 565,000
For Sale
£ 655,000
For Sale
£ 1,175,000
For Sale
£ 500,000
For Sale
£ 645,000
For Sale
£ 725,000
For Sale
£ 732,950
For Sale
£ 375,000
For Sale
£ 180,000
For Sale
£ 799,000
For Sale
£ 1,195,000
For Sale
£ 1,900,000
For Sale
£ 1,375,000
For Sale
£ 2,250,000
For Sale
£ 965,000
For Sale
£ 775,000
For Sale
£ 825,000
For Sale
£ 599,950
For Sale
£ 680,000
For Sale
£ 675,000